Finding GCD of 229, 817, 296, 501 using Prime Factorization

Given Input Data is 229, 817, 296, 501

Make a list of Prime Factors of all the given numbers initially

Prime Factorization of 229 is 229

Prime Factorization of 817 is 19 x 43

Prime Factorization of 296 is 2 x 2 x 2 x 37

Prime Factorization of 501 is 3 x 167

The above numbers do not have any common prime factor. So GCD is 1
